Low-Glucose (0.5%) EMM2

Reagent Quantity (for 1 L) Final concentration
Ammonium chloride    5 g 93.5 mm
Potassium hydrogen phthalate    3 g 14.7 mm
Na2HPO4   2.2 g 15.5 mm
Glucose    5 g   28 mm
Salt stock (50×)  20 mL    1×
Vitamins (1000×)   1 mL    1×
Minerals (10,000×) 0.1 mL    1×
H2O  to 1 L
Prepare 1 L of low-glucose (0.5%) EMM2 by combining the reagents above. To prepare solid medium, include agar (20 g/L). Sterilize by autoclaving at 10 psi for 10 min (for liquid medium) or 15 min (for solid medium). If desired, add 12 μm thiamine (364 μL of a filter-sterilized stock solution of 10 mg/mL in H2O) to repress expression from nmt1-derived promoters (Maundrell 1990). (For liquid medium, low pressure and a short cycle is essential to avoid caramelization of glucose and breakdown of vitamins and minerals. Store at 4°C.
